Representative Bly moved that the minutes of January 11, 2007 be adopted. THE MOTION PREVAILED.


Overview of Department of Human Services (DHS) childcare programs.

Chuck Johnson, Assistant Commissioner for Children and Families
Testified about children's services provided by DHS.

Deb Swenson-Klatt, Manager, Early Childhood Development
Testified about childcare services, funding and quality.

Katie Williams, Director of Early Childhood Programs, Minneapolis YWCA
Testified about programs at the YWCA and the outcomes.

Cherie Kotilinek, Manager, Child Care Assistance Program (CCAP)
Testified about DHS CCAP.


The meeting was adjourned at 5:29 p.m.
